"Simply put, I fundamentally believe it isn't appropriate for former aides to cash in by writing kiss-and-tell novels... As old fashioned as it sounds, I also believe in the idea that you ought to treat someone how you would want to be treated in similar circumstances. If someone places their trust in you, you're faced with a clear choice of either validating or violating that trust."
-- Joel Sawyer, former communications director for South Carolina Gov. Mark Sanford, writing for the Ripon Forum.
